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
925710883 360527096 99319939 998
11672932 61450 3877144610
11672932 61450 3877144610
41122470 78236 73158301
All about undefined
Interested in learning more?
11672932 61450 3877144610
41122470 78236 73158301
See more
0932 35255205
21320 705675089 82067 988
See more
939 7558
38725798406 133 23981 23089246
See more